Southampton Watch Show 2026

Watch lovers and collectors can get ready for a fantastic day out on the south coast! On Saturday 4 July 2026, the premium event rooms inside St. Mary’s Stadium (Britannia Road, Southampton, SO14 5FP) will host the first-ever Southampton Watch Show. Running from 10:00 AM until 16:00 (4:00 PM), this hands-on exhibition lets you try on hundreds of beautiful watches, discover exciting independent brands, and get special discounts that are only available on the day.

Quick Summary: What can you expect at the Southampton Watch Show?

Visitors can expect a completely relaxed, hands-on exhibition inside the home of Southampton FC where you can interact directly with 30 leading European watch brands.

  • Meet Brand Founders: Talk directly with independent watchmakers and try on hundreds of unique timepieces without retail glass counters.
  • Exclusive Event Discounts: Access special on-the-day price reductions, unique strap deals, and custom ordering options from official exhibitors.
  • Free Pitchside Stadium Tours: Enjoy free behind-the-scenes stadium tours of St. Mary’s, available throughout the day on a first-come, first-served basis.




Southampton Watch Show Event Schedule and Timings

The Southampton Watch Show features a structured six-hour program allowing plenty of time to explore the exhibition halls and take in the stadium scenery:

  • 10:00 AM: Exhibition Doors Open — Registration opens at the main hospitality entrance. All 30 exhibitor stands, including premium spaces for Bamford London and Christopher Ward, begin trading.
  • 11:00 AM: Pitchside Stadium Tours Begin — The first exclusive behind-the-scenes stadium tours commence. Groups depart regularly from the designated meeting point inside the main suite on a rolling basis.
  • 13:00 (1:00 PM): Peak Exhibition Hours — The busiest period for testing timepieces, custom strap fittings, and interactive Q&A sessions with independent brand founders.
  • 15:00 (3:00 PM): Final Stadium Tour Departure — The last allocation for the first-come, first-served pitchside stadium tours leaves the exhibition floor.
  • 16:00 (4:00 PM): Event Concludes — The exhibition stands close, on-the-day discounts expire, and the venue halls clear.

2026 Exhibitor Line-Up

The Southampton Watch Show brings together an exceptional mix of luxury watchmakers, famous heritage names, and highly sought-after independent microbrands. Here is your official exhibitor showcase for the 2026 event:

Premium Exhibitors

  • Bamford London: Famous for high-end custom styling and striking, modern luxury sports watch designs.
  • Christopher Ward: A pioneer in British watchmaking, celebrated globally for bringing top-tier Swiss-made mechanical complications to accessible price points.

Exhibitors & Independent Microbrands

  • Abinger: Classic, finely crafted everyday dress and field watches.
  • Adley: Clean, minimalist timepieces inspired by modern architecture and design.
  • Alpharo: Emerging independent watchmaker focusing on bold aesthetics and reliable mechanics.
  • Bamford: Precision engineered sports watches, chronographs, and lifestyle timepieces.
  • Beaucroft: Elegantly styled British dress watches featuring beautiful, artistic custom dial work.
  • Baltic: Highly acclaimed vintage-inspired dive watches, chronographs, and field pieces with neo-retro styling.
  • Brunel: Independent watchmaker specializing in rugged, reliable everyday tools and tool watches.
  • Done: Contemporary Swiss-made watches featuring unique architectural case shapes.
  • Duckworth Prestex: A revival of a historic British brand, offering high-quality heritage styles with a classic 1920s cushion-case aesthetic.
  • Dwiss: Innovative, multi-award-winning design house known for displaying time using creative wandering hours and floating discs.
  • Elliot Brown: Practically indestructible, military-grade British tool watches built to survive the harshest outdoor conditions.
  • Emilie Chouriet: Traditional, elegant Swiss luxury dress watches inspired by classic Geneva watchmaking history.
  • Epos: High-end mechanical Swiss watches renowned for intricately skeletonized dials and artistic movements.
  • Edward Christopher: Luxury sports-chic watches that proudly invest a portion of their profits to help support vulnerable children.
  • Ember: Modern microbrand creating clean, lifestyle-focused everyday automatic timepieces.
  • Escudo: British-Portuguese brand crafting luxury vintage-inspired marine chronometers and dive watches.
  • Furlan Marri: Independent brand that took the watch world by storm with ultra-detailed, mid-century inspired story chronographs.
  • Golby: Bespoke independent watchmaker crafting ultra-exclusive custom pieces and custom modifications.
  • Horage: Advanced Swiss micro-engineering powerhouse crafting true in-house movements, silicon escapes, and accessible tourbillons.
  • Marloe: Independent mechanical watch company from Scotland, creating unique hand-wound and automatic watches with deep storytelling elements.
  • McQuaide: Emerging contemporary microbrand specializing in minimalist styles and clean profiles.
  • Mezei: Boutique watchmaker focusing on precise geometric details and highly technical custom dial engineering.
  • MicroMispec: Specialized, rugged timepieces designed around strict utility and technical specifications.
  • Rafter: Sporty, robust tool watches built for everyday outdoor adventures and active lifestyles.
  • Ralph Tech: Extreme professional diving watches, engineered for and trusted by elite naval forces and deep-sea divers.
  • Sortie: Aviation-themed watches celebrating traditional flight instrument panels and pilot watch heritage.
  • Vario: Infinitely creative Singaporean microbrand blending vintage retro styles, 1918 trench watch styles, and unique custom straps.
  • WatchGecko: The ultimate destination for premium replacement watch straps, lifestyle accessories, and curation tools.

Ticket Tiers

Tickets for the Southampton Watch Show 2026 are split into timed general admission brackets and specialized entry options. Please select the appropriate ticket for your arrival time or group type:

  • 10:00 AM Entry Ticket: £13.00 (£12.00 admission + £1.00 booking fee) — Provides early-bird access to the main exhibition floor from 10:00 AM onwards.
  • 12:00 PM Entry Ticket: £13.00 (£12.00 admission + £1.00 booking fee) — Provides midday access to the exhibition floor from 12:00 PM onwards.
  • 2:00 PM Entry Ticket: £13.00 (£12.00 admission + £1.00 booking fee) — Provides late afternoon access to the exhibition floor from 2:00 PM onwards.
  • Student Ticket: £6.00 (No booking fee) — Available to students. Ticket holders must present a valid, current student photo ID card from a recognized educational institution upon arrival.
  • Child’s Ticket: FREE — Required for children under 16. All children must be accompanied by an adult upon entry and at all times throughout the event.
  • Carer’s Ticket: FREE — Available for those accompanying and supporting an attendee with additional access or support needs.
  • Behind the Scenes Stadium Tour (11:00 AM, 1:00 PM, or 3:00 PM): FREE — Add-on ticket to enjoy a guided behind-the-scenes tour of St. Mary’s Stadium. Full re-entry to the watch show is permitted immediately after your tour slot concludes.

Entry Policies

To ensure a comfortable browsing experience and manage crowd safety inside the hospitality suites, you must arrive at the venue according to the specific time slot printed on your ticket.

  • ID Verification: Concession ticket holders (Students) must present active, official identification at the registration desks to validate their discounted entry.
  • Child Supervision: Children under the age of 16 cannot wander the exhibition halls or take part in stadium tours independently; they must remain with a ticket-holding adult at all times.
  • Exhibitor Buying and Transactions: While browsing and trying on watches is highly encouraged, on-the-day purchases and custom microbrand orders are handled directly by each individual brand’s secure point-of-sale terminal. Standard stadium security bag checks will apply at the venue entrance.
Local Tip: Because the stadium pitchside tours are handled strictly on a first-come, first-served basis, make it your absolute priority to sign up at the information desk the moment you pass through registration at 10:00 AM. This ensures you secure a midday slot, leaving your afternoon completely open to browse the microbrand tables without rushing.

How to Get There

The event takes place inside the modern hospitality suites of St. Mary’s Stadium, Britannia Road, Southampton, SO14 5FP:

  • By Bus: Take the Bluestar line 18 or First City Red line 3, both dropping passengers off on nearby Northam Road or Brintons Road, followed by a flat, scenic 5-to-10-minute walk down the stadium approach paths.
  • By Train: Southampton Central Railway Station is located roughly 1.1 miles west of the venue. Visitors can take a direct 20-to-25-minute walk through the city center or hop in a taxi from the station forecourt for a 5-minute drive.
  • By Bicycle: Excellent secure bicycle parking racks are situated directly outside the stadium’s main reception area and the megastore entrance.

Where to Park near St. Mary’s Stadium

There is no general public event parking permitted in the main stadium lot on non-matchdays. Visitors are advised to utilize these official local council and secure private parking facilities located nearby:

  • Six Dials Car Park: A large, convenient open-air municipal council car park located roughly an 8-minute flat walk west of the stadium gates, operating on standard, budget-friendly hourly rates.
  • Northam Road Car Park: Situated just a short 5-minute walk from the venue grounds, this dedicated surface car park offers rapid, easy access straight to the stadium’s Northam stand approach.
  • Ocean Village Surface Car Park: Located roughly a 17-minute walk south of the stadium, this large waterfront parking facility is an excellent option if you plan to pair your watch show visit with dinner or drinks along the marina.
